The Attention of the Management of Kwara State College of Education, Ilorin has been drawn to some trending fake news items on the social media. The fake news has it that the Provost of the College Dr. AbdulRaheem Yusuf led the student peaceful rally to the Government House in the early hours of today and that some students were injured in the rally while some vehicles were vandalized by the students.

The College wishes to state unequivocally that the Provost of the College, as a peace loving administrator and an advocate of stable academic calendar who believes in negotiation as a way of solving problems, will not mastermind such an unpopular act let alone be an active participant.

Earlier in the day, when the students came to lay their grievances before the Provost, as a father, he informed them that the State Government was already addressing all the issues raised by the aggrieved students. He therefore pleaded with them to go back to their respective hostels, lecture rooms or library as the case may be in continuation of their readiness for the ongoing second semester examination.

How could, a person who did this and immediately went into a close-door meeting with the union leaders, have been the mastermind of the said rally. (A video clip of the Provost's address to the students is available in the College for clarifications)

We equally wish to state that while no vehicle was neither destroyed nor vandalized, not a single student was injured in the process. Parents and the general public are to therefore note for the purpose of emphasis that uninterrupted academic activities and the safety of our students is of utmost importance to us in the College. The fake news, which as far as the College is concerned is a figment of the imaginations of the College's enemies, who are bent on peddling rumors deliberately meant to malign her image and undermine the good work of the Dr. AbdulRaheem Yusuf led administration, should be disregarded.
